Objectives

  • To identify the needs of and problems impacting upon the migrant and seasonal farmworker population.

  • To research and document the issues related to the migrant and seasonal farmworker population.

  • To identify resources that are currently available.

  • To identify resources that need to be developed.

  • To identify strategies for securing the needed resources.

  • To establish target areas for action and create sub and ad hoc committees to respond to specific needs.

  • To develop action plans with specific assignments and timetables to achieve and/or advance each priority goal.

  • To establish a reporting system to monitor the progress of each sub and ad hoc committee.

  • To document the accomplishments and areas of concern of the Committee.

  • To share the Committee results with the migrant and seasonal farmworker community and appropriate state and federal department directors, Michigan congressional delegation, the state legislature and the Governor.
